A Week in Kashmir: A Family-Friendly Adventure

Day 1: Friday, October 20 - Arrival in Srinagar

Start your unforgettable journey in Srinagar, the capital city of Jammu and Kashmir. In the morning, take a leisurely Shikara ride on the serene Dal Lake, surrounded by breathtaking views of snow-capped mountains. In the afternoon, visit the Mughal Gardens, including Nishat Bagh and Shalimar Bagh, known for their stunning terraced gardens. As the evening approaches, explore the bustling local markets and try delicious Kashmiri cuisine.

  • Dal Lake Shikara Ride: Approx. cost INR 500, 2 hours
  • Mughal Gardens: Approx. cost INR 250, 2-3 hours
  • Local Markets: Free, 2-3 hours

Day 2: Saturday, October 21 - Pahalgam's Natural Wonders

Embark on a scenic journey to Pahalgam, a picturesque hill station situated on the banks of the Lidder River. In the morning, explore the beautiful Betaab Valley, known for its lush green meadows and charming surroundings. After lunch, visit the enchanting Aru Valley, surrounded by snow-capped peaks and scenic landscapes. Spend the evening strolling along the Lidder River and enjoying the tranquility of this mountain paradise.

  • Betaab Valley: Approx. cost INR 100, 2-3 hours
  • Aru Valley: Approx. cost INR 150, 2-3 hours
  • Lidder River Walk: Free, 1-2 hours

Day 3: Sunday, October 22 - Exploring Gulmarg

Head to Gulmarg, a popular skiing destination known for its lush meadows and stunning landscapes. In the morning, take a gondola ride to Apharwat Peak, offering panoramic views of the snow-covered Himalayan peaks. Grab a quick bite at one of the local eateries and spend the afternoon enjoying various activities like horse riding or golfing. As the day comes to an end, witness a breathtaking sunset and enjoy a peaceful evening in the Himalayan paradise.

  • Gulmarg Gondola: Approx. cost INR 650, 3-4 hours
  • Horse Riding or Golfing: Approx. cost INR 500, 2-3 hours
  • Sunset Point: Free, 1-2 hours
Day 4: Monday, October 23 - Serenity at Sonamarg

Travel to Sonamarg, also known as the "Meadow of Gold," famous for its pristine beauty and Thajiwas Glacier. In the morning, explore the glacier while enjoying activities like snowboarding or sledging in the breathtaking surroundings. Afterward, take a leisurely stroll along the Sindh River and soak in the tranquil atmosphere. Spend the evening unwinding at your hotel and enjoying the peaceful ambiance of Sonamarg.

  • Thajiwas Glacier: Approx. cost INR 200, 2-3 hours
  • Sindh River Walk: Free, 1-2 hours
  • Relaxation and Hotel Facilities: Varies
Day 5: Tuesday, October 24 - Discovering the Ancient Ruins of Martand Sun Temple

Visit the Martand Sun Temple, an ancient architectural marvel dedicated to the Sun God. Marvel at the intricate stone carvings and the panoramic views of the surrounding mountains. Enjoy a picnic in the temple's serene surroundings or explore nearby villages to experience the local culture. Spend the evening at leisure, enjoying the tranquility of nature.

  • Martand Sun Temple: Free, 2-3 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ique experience, consider visiting the floating vegetable gardens of Dal Lake, where locals grow vegetables on traditional boats. Another off-the-beaten-path attraction is Dachigam National Park, home to endangered species like the hangul (Kashmiri stag) and the Kashmiri gray langur. These hidden gems offer a glimpse into the rich culture and biodiversity of Kashmir, making your trip even more memorable for the whole family.
